Logging in via Web Browser
- Navigate to the Login Page: Visit monday.com and click on the “Log in” button located at the top right corner of the homepage.
- Enter Your Credentials:
- Email Address: Input the email associated with your monday.com account.
- Password: Enter your password. If you’ve forgotten it, select the “Forgot your password?” link to initiate a reset.
- Account URL: If prompted, provide your account’s unique URL, typically formatted as yourteam.monday.com.
- Access Your Account: Click “Log in” to enter your monday.com workspace.

Logging in via Desktop Application
- Download the App: Ensure the monday.com desktop app is installed on your computer. You can download it from the official website.
- Open the Application: Launch the app and select your preferred login method:
- Email and Password: Enter your registered email and password.
- Third-Party Services: Opt to log in using Google, Slack, or LinkedIn credentials.
- Browser Login: Alternatively, use the “Use Browser Login” feature, which redirects you to your web browser for authentication. After approving the login, you’ll receive a six-digit passcode to enter back into the desktop app.
Logging in via Mobile Application
- Download the App: Install the monday.com mobile app from the iOS App Store or Google Play Store.
- Launch the App: Open the app and choose “Log in”.
- Enter Credentials:
- Email: Provide your registered email address.
- Password: Input your password.
- Alternative Login Options: You can also log in using Google, Apple (for iOS), Slack, or LinkedIn accounts.
- Account URL: If you have multiple accounts associated with your email, enter your specific account URL when prompted.
Common Login Issues and Troubleshooting
- Incorrect Credentials: Ensure that your email and password are entered correctly. If you’ve forgotten your password, use the “Forgot your password?” feature to reset it.
- Inactive User or Account: If you receive a message stating “User is inactive,” contact your account administrator to reactivate your user profile or the entire account.
- Two-Factor Authentication (2FA) Issues: If you’re unable to complete the 2FA process, request your account admin to reset your 2FA settings. They can do this by navigating to “Administration” > “Users” and selecting “Reset Two-Factor Authentication” for your profile.
- Browser-Related Problems: If you encounter issues while using a web browser, try clearing your cache and cookies, or use an incognito window to rule out extension conflicts.
- Platform Status: Occasionally, login issues may arise from platform outages. Check the monday.com Status Page for real-time updates on system performance.
Best Practices for Seamless Access
- Bookmark Your Account URL: Save your unique monday.com URL for quick access.
- Keep Software Updated: Regularly update your web browser, desktop, and mobile applications to the latest versions to ensure compatibility.
- Secure Your Credentials: Use strong, unique passwords and consider enabling two-factor authentication for enhanced security.
FAQ
- How do I reset my monday.com password?
- Click on the “Forgot your password?” link on the login page, enter your registered email, and follow the instructions sent to your email to reset your password.
- What should I do if I receive an “Unsupported location” error?
- This message indicates that access from your current location is restricted. Contact monday.com support for assistance.
- Can I use third-party accounts to log in to monday.com?
- Yes, monday.com supports login via Google, Slack, LinkedIn, and Apple (for iOS) accounts.
